RICHMOND, Va. (Oct. 6, 2025) … The Hampton University men's tennis team competed in the River City Open over the weekend. The Pirates put together a record of 7-7 in singles and 3-1 in doubles over the course of the three day tournament.
Freshman, Tshion Fedorov led the Pirates on the weekend putting together a perfect 3-0 weekend in singles while also adding a win in doubles. Rafael Padilha added a strong performance for Hampton as well, posting a 2-1 singles record and went 2-0 in doubles.
